Tasting Table Series

Our Tasting Table Series brings people together around a shared table to celebrate the makers behind the pour. Each event highlights exceptional veteran- and first responder-owned producers, local farmers, and independent brands connected to the C.R.A.F.T. mission. These gatherings serve as both voices for the community and fundraisers for our mentorship, education, and history programs. Every plate shared and every glass raised helps preserve tradition and create opportunity for those who serve.

The People's Pour Awards™

Our signature Beer & Spirits Competition celebrates the best of what the C.R.A.F.T. community has to offer. Focused on brands connected to our mission, the competition introduces these producers to new audiences and lets the public cast their vote through the People's Pour Awards™. It's more than a contest — it's a platform to showcase quality, creativity, and the craftsmanship of those who pour their service into every bottle.

Mentorship

Mentorship is the foundation of who we are — and what the military does best. Through the C.R.A.F.T. Mentorship Network, we connect veterans who want to enter the adult beverage industry with those already leading within it. Our mentors provide guidance, connections, and shared experience — ensuring no one walks this path alone. Together, we are building a powerful support network where veterans lift each other up, one pour at a time.

The Veterans' History Project

The story of America's beverage industry is also the story of its veterans. Our Veterans' History Project seeks to illustrate, preserve, and share the influence of those who've served — from the earliest days of the American Revolution to the distilleries, breweries, and bars shaping today's landscape. Through interviews, archives, and storytelling, we honor the men and women whose service continues to define the flavor of our nation. This living history ensures their legacy will never be forgotten — and always be celebrated.

About the Organization

Coalition to Represent American Flavor & Tradition (C.R.A.F.T.) is a national nonprofit serving the veteran and first-responder craft beverage community — from production and distribution to hospitality and retail. C.R.A.F.T. is a 501(c)(3) public charity (EIN 41-2963950), tax-exempt effective December 8, 2025. Contributions are tax-deductible to the extent allowed by law.

Mission & Geographic Scope

C.R.A.F.T. advances veteran and first-responder entrepreneurship across the craft beverage industry — brewing, distilling, hospitality, and distribution — connecting independent producers with the resources, networks, and audiences that help them grow. We serve veteran- and first-responder-owned brands across the United States.
